Basically, polycarbonate is a plastic, and this kind of plastic reacts with citrus, cinnamon, vegetable oils (VG), and alot of other stuff. It's called Environmental Stress Cracking (ESC). So it basically is resilient to PG, and juices with artificial flavoring. That's it in a nut-shell.

The list of juices that will crack it is endless, due to the facts above.

I don't think VG cracks tanks. Myself and many others use 100% VG in our tanks. Can't live without my Boba's.
